Focus and Scope

Journal of Safety Engineering and Risk Control (JSERC) aims to advance engineering solutions that reduce industrial risks and improve operational safety. It specialises in process safety, risk modelling, mechanical safety, and human factors. Its advantage is broad applicability across chemical, civil, mechanical, petroleum, and industrial engineering, ensuring a steady and diverse submission flow.

  • Industrial safety systems and engineering controls for hazard prevention
  • Accident modelling, incident analysis and risk factor identification
  • Process safety approaches for chemical, mechanical and industrial operations
  • Occupational health engineering and protection strategies
  • Fire, explosion and thermal hazard mitigation frameworks
  • Structural, mechanical and electrical safety assessment
  • Safety culture, human factors and behavioural aspects of risk
  • Risk modelling, predictive methods and AI enhanced safety analytics
